Job Summary Urologist needed for the Department of Urology at Geisinger Medical Center. The role involves providing exceptional patient care, engaging in clinical research, and teaching residents in a fully accredited program. Position Highlights State‑of‑the‑art technology: robotic systems, high‑powered lasers, transperitoneal/fusion biopsies, Robotic Aquablation, Rezum. Collaborative environment with shared weekend call (1:9) and support from advanced practitioners and residents. Academic opportunities: potential appointment through Geisinger Commonwealth School of Medicine and accredited residency program. Benefits: fully paid relocation, generous PTO (4 weeks), annual CME time (3 weeks), malpractice & T&A coverage, 401(k), 403(b), 457(b), life insurance, AD&D, disability coverage. Integrated electronic health record (EPIC). Professional growth through mentorship and advancement opportunities. Responsibilities Provide high‑quality clinical care to patients, perform diagnostic and therapeutic urologic procedures, participate in clinical research, mentor residents, and contribute to academic publishing and teaching activities. Ideal Candidate Board‑eligible or Board‑certified urologist desiring a work‑life balance with excellence in patient care. Must be licensed in Pennsylvania and able to contribute to clinical research and resident education. Education & Qualifications Education: Doctor of Medicine or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ine. Experience: Urologic residency or equivalent clinical experience. Licensure: Licensed Medical Doctor in the State of Pennsylvania. Skills: Patient care and procedural skills; professional etiquette; systems‑based practice.
